Output 61d32afac38a7684234949aa81465924877baada981f9676c3bbc72c14699742:0

value
756666
script pubkey
OP_0 OP_PUSHBYTES_20 422f225e2a057af817461cc0168521bd52e20488
address
bc1qgghjyh32q4a0s96xrnqpdpfph4fwypyg84r3cj
transaction
61d32afac38a7684234949aa81465924877baada981f9676c3bbc72c14699742
spent
true